Synopsis: Enterprise is ordered to transport a Vulcan ambassador from her current assignment on a planet called Mazar to a Vulcan ship. Archer gets second guesses about his mission when Enterprise comes under attack by the Mazarites and the Vulcans refuse to tell them why.

Pros:
- The best thing about this episode would have to be the chase
scene where Enterprise trys to outrun the Mazarite ships. It was one of the most exciting scenes of the entire series so far.
- One of my main complaints about Enterprise has always been how it seems to portray Vulcans as villians, however this episode looks to be the first step in changing that. How adventurely V'Lar trusts Archer and humans in general.
- Hey, for once Tripp is actaually
in engineering. "He must be the only engineer in starfleet that doesn't go to engineering."
- I like this Admiral Foster character, it shows that Admirals in this time period were alot cooler than the one in the future. When Archer tells Foster that "You could always order me back." Foster replies, "It's you're call. You're out there and I'm not." It's much better than the admirals on TNG and DS9 who threw their weight around telling the captains exactly what and what not to do.
- This episode also goes well to establishing Archer's leadership skills, instead of bumbling around like an idoit like he usaully does, In this episode he takes charge.
- The scene at the end where they bluff the Mazarites to make them believe that they killed ambassador V'Lar was great. We find out that Doctor Phlox is a very good actor.
